This mod can also be used with Fluffy manager. But unfortunately it's not packed in a way that the manager understands so it won't work as is. Here's the fix: - Download the archive from Nexus - Extract the files - put the "ep0b.arc" and "pl0b.arc" files in a New Folder. Rename the new folder to "pl". - Make a another new folder called "arc". Put the "pl" folder into the "arc" folder. - Make another folder (last time, I promise :) ) called "nativePC". Put the "arc" folder containing the "pl" folder into the "nativePC" folder" - Compress the "nativePC" folder into RAR format and give it a name you can remember...Like "Classic RE1 Jill" or whatever. - Add this to the mods folder in Fluffy Manager (Fluffy manager folder > Games > REHD > Mods)
Launch the mod manager, select your game and the mods. Enjoy!
@flameshiva In the root folder for a mod, you'll want to make a text file called modinfo.ini. Its contents can look something like this: name=Crazy Mod version=v1.0 description=This crazy mod does some crazy stuff.\n\nBelieve me, you ain't seen nothing yet. author=Crazy Modder Person category=Animations category=Enemies homepage=patreon.Crazy modder person screenshot=preview.jpg
